Non-woven fabric suitable for scratch prevention and noise prevention.
This is a new type of non-woven fabric that complies with high-level environmental regulations, without using any halogen compounds or formaldehyde, in response to RoHS regulations and the VOC regulations of various automobile manufacturers. It also excels in functionality and demonstrates its characteristics in various fields. 【Features】 - Active in a wide range of fields - Scratch prevention - Noise prevention Himeron® (Manufacturer: Ambic Co., Ltd.) basic information
【Specifications】 ○ Non-flammable Series → Thickness: 0.15mm to 0.90mm → Color: Black → Basis weight g/m2: 30 to 225 → Standard: 1000mm × 50M → Flame retardant standard: Non-flammable type ○ Non-flammable Series → Thickness: 1.50mm/1.80mm → Color: Black → Basis weight g/m2: 280/335 → Standard: 1000mm × 1000mm → Flame retardant standard: Non-flammable type ○ Flame Retardant Series → Thickness: 0.15mm to 0.90mm → Color: Black → Basis weight g/m2: 35 to 200 → Standard: 1000mm × 50M → Flame retardant standard: FMVSS302 compliant ○ Flame Retardant Series → Thickness: 0.25mm to 0.90mm → Color: Black → Basis weight g/m2: 66 to 230 → Standard: 1000mm × 50M → Flame retardant standard: UL94V-0 compliant ○ Needle Felt → Thickness: 0.50mm to 5.0mm → Color: Black → Basis weight g/m2: 120 to 830 → Standard: 1000mm × 50M to 20M random → Flame retardant standard: Non-flammable type ● For more details, please contact us or download the catalog.

Tokai Felt Co., Ltd., established in 1946 in Hamamatsu City, Shizuoka Prefecture, set up its factory in Hamamatsu and its sales office in Ginza, Tokyo, where it manufactured and sold cow hair felt and coarse hair felt. In 1953, aiming for further significant development, the Tokyo sales office was separated and established as Tsukasa Felt Trading Co., Ltd. Tsukasa Felt Trading Co., Ltd. has operated as the general agent for the aforementioned factory and as a special distributor for Nippon Woolen Co., Ltd., Nippon Felt Industry Co., Ltd. (now Ambic Co., Ltd.), Fujiko Co., Ltd., and Fuji Felt Co., Ltd., handling all types of felt as a "department store of felt." Furthermore, we also provide a wide range of synthetic products such as glass wool, urethane foam, and polyethylene foam, which are used as industrial components, similar to felt. Additionally, we have received favorable feedback from related users for medical tubes and precision-shaped tubes produced by special extrusion machines. Our writing instrument pen core business, which started with the production of pen cores for felt pens, has also expanded to include the manufacturing of chemical fiber binding cores (synthetic cores), extruded plastic cores, and metal ball tips, which are used in various writing instruments such as marking pens and ballpoint pens, receiving recognition both domestically and internationally.
